House Trim Installation in Conroe, TX

House trim installation services involve adding or updating decorative and functional moldings, baseboards, crown molding, window casings, door trims, and other finishing details around a property’s interior or exterior. These projects typically enhance the aesthetic appeal of a home, provide a polished look to walls and doorways, and can also help improve the overall durability of surfaces. Property owners often request trim installation when renovating, updating outdated styles, or seeking to add architectural character to their spaces, ensuring that the details complement the overall design of the home.

Before requesting house trim install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, the types of trim options available, and how the installation process may impact their property. It’s helpful to consider the style of trim that matches the home’s architecture, the materials best suited for durability and appearance, and any specific design preferences. Clarifying these details can ensure the project aligns with the homeowner’s vision and that the finished results meet their expectations.

Project Types

Common House Trim Installation Jobs

Interior trim installation - enhances room aesthetics with new baseboards, crown molding, or door casings.

Exterior trim updates - improves curb appeal by replacing or adding siding trim, window casings, and soffits.

Custom trim accents - adds unique character through decorative moldings and detailed finishes.

Door and window trim - provides a polished look while protecting edges and framing openings.

Recessed and shadow box trim - creates depth and visual interest on interior walls and features.

Trim repair services - restores damaged or worn trim to improve appearance and function.

FAQ

House Trim Installation Questions

What types of trim can be installed on a house? Common options include crown molding, baseboards, window casings, and door trim to enhance interior and exterior appearances.

How does house trim installation improve property value? Well-chosen and properly installed trim can add aesthetic appeal and character, potentially increasing the home's overall value.

Is house trim installation suitable for both interior and exterior projects? Yes, trim can be installed on interior walls, doors, and windows, as well as exterior facades and architectural features.

What materials are typically used for house trim? Common materials include wood, MDF, PVC, and composite options, each offering different durability and style choices.
